GLOBE AROMA / IRMA FIRMA - 'HOME AND AWAY'
Together with a mixed group of expats, homeless people and refugees, the artist Ann Van de Vyvere (Irma Firma) looked for the meaning of privacy and intimacy – the foundations of the home. Because, wherever a person lives, be it in a terraced house or under a bridge, he always gathers around him a number of valuable objects to create a sense of home. The Home & away exhibition was first put together at the Jubilee Park Museum in April 2010. A group of the participants are now getting together again to exhibit their most valuable objects at the Kaaitheater.The documentary film showing the exhibitors’ stories will premiere at the Kaaitheater on Wednesday, November 24.

TANJA OSTOJIĆ - 'NAKED LIFE'
The performances and public interventions by the Serbian artist Tanja Ostojić address the theme of female migrants in the EU. In doing so, she often throws her own body into the battle. Naked Life deals with discrimination against the Roma and Sinti.

LISA VAN DAMME - 'ROMA IN GHENT' 
In December last year a group of Roma were in the news because they had to spend the winter in Ghent in a Nigerian or Congolese-style slum. The young Ghent-based social photographer Lisa Van Damme compiled an incisive and respectful report on them.

ADRIAN PACI - 'CENTRO DI PERMANENZA TEMPORANEA'
The poster image for Spoken World 2010 comes from the video Centro di Permanenza Temporanea (2007) by the Milan-based Albanian artist Adrian Paci. The title refers to an Italian refugee camp. Paci often incorporates his experiences as a refugee into his videos, sculptures, installations, photographs and paintings.
